For those who have been paying attention, Microsoft and Sony are currently in the process of closing out this current generation of concolse hardware for the Xbox One and PlayStation 4. That we already know, however, the idea of what the new systems will look like has been left pending until the company is properly ready to disclose.

While we do know some of the specs for both upcoming Project Scarlett and the inevitable PlayStation 5, the physical unit as of now has no appearance for users to get a grasp of for the next line of consoles. But according to a tweet from a developer at Codemasters, the first glimpse of the next generation is here.

In response to an article from Metro, Senior Artist Matt Stott shares that the image headlining the piece is in fact the devkit for the unannounced PlayStation 5.

https://twitter.com/matt_stott_72/status/1164067840976195585

Just from looking at the blueprints for the developer model, this sure is a look into the future. In all seriousness, it should be reminded that this is only the devkit and the retail model for the PlayStation 5 will look, hopefully, a lot more different than what we are currently looking at.

Looking at the image for the devkit, one eye grabbing segment is the amount of USB ports that are sitting on the front of the unit with five in contrast to the two on the current PlayStation 4. Another nitpick atop of the incessant amount of ports is the countless number of vents surrounding the entire model, obviously. Although it is expected as stated before that what is shown will be adjusted for the base model, the characteristics for the hardware could be altered as well.
